码迷,mamicode.com
首页 > 其他好文 > 详细

怎么单独为ionic2应用的某一组件设置两个平台一致的样式

时间:2017-05-12 20:20:59      阅读:284      评论:0      收藏:0      [点我收藏+]

标签:cordova   port   nic   android5   for   ade   平台   header   ports   

今天在继续项目的过程中,发现ionic2在显示样式上是根据不同的平台采用不同的样式,使在不同平台上的应用保持相应的风格,于是问题来了。

ios的风格比较好看,android的风格略微不如ios的,所以想统一样式,网上搜了一下,有这个方法

//在app.module.ts文件中
imports: [ 
        IonicModule.forRoot(MyApp, { 
            backButtonText: ‘‘, 
            iconMode: ‘ios‘, 
            mode: ‘ios‘,
        }), 
],

 但是这样子在android下头部的样式会偏高,可以采用如下样式解决问题

.platform-android5,.platform-android6,.platform-android7{      //安卓头部状态栏偏高
//ion-header {
// padding-top: $cordova-md-statusbar-padding;
//
//}
.toolbar-ios{
padding-top: 0;
padding-bottom: 0;
}

怎么单独为ionic2应用的某一组件设置两个平台一致的样式

标签:cordova   port   nic   android5   for   ade   平台   header   ports   

原文地址:http://www.cnblogs.com/shitoupi/p/6846811.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!